Description
As an Assessor Assistant, you will perform independent complex technical fieldwork involving the inspection of properties, gathering of data and other tasks related to the assessment function. Responsibilities will include:
Inspecting, measuring and recording specific data and attributes respecting all real property and business premises, as well as recording all relevant information.
Entering and collecting data using a wireless remote data collection device.
Assisting Assessor III's, Assessor II's and Assessor I's in valuations.
Inspecting business premises and collecting rental data.
Updating data on computer, including complex and/or unusual properties.
Reviewing and checking data entries and outputs of own work and that of others.
Assisting and working with Assessors in the review and final calculations of assessments.
Preparing and maintaining comprehensive field records for sketches, diagrams and other relevant data.
Attending meetings, appeals and hearings and participating as directed.
Assisting in developing and improving assessment methods and procedures.
Performing other related work as assigned.
Qualifications
Completion of the 1st year of the UBC Certificate Program in Real Property Assessment, one course of which must be Building Construction, or preferably the completion of the Appraisal and Assessment Diploma from Lakeland College
Additional training or experience in accounting and/or finance would be considered an asset
Knowledge of construction material and techniques involved in the assessment of residential, commercial, industrial, multi-residential and business premises, including market values of all types of land
Considerable knowledge of data required to calculate assessments
Ability to meet and deal courteously and tactfully with internal and external customers
Valid Alberta Driver’s License
Working knowledge of standard desktop applications and Apex sketching software
